1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 | April 23, 1787 King Louis XVI's speech before the Assembly. He concedes to nearly all objections of the Notables, even agrees to let them have a peak into his accounts. But he still wants the land tax. May 1, 1787 The new finance minister is one of the Notables — Étienne-Charles de Loménie de Brienne, Archbishop of Toulouse. What will his strategy be? Abolish privileges and impose a land tax. Louis fired Calonne, but not his reforms. |
